Handover — evening shift, Quillstone Labs. Tomas from the infrastructure team needs after-hours access to the server room on level B1 between 22:00 and midnight tonight. Please verify his staff badge on arrival, log the entry time in the red binder, and remind him the room must be relocked on exit. The server room keypad accepts the code below.

badge for yahag-yajep: bdg-N-77

Subject: Key rotation — migration service

Team,

As part of the zero-downtime schema migration work on Ledgerfold, we rotated the credentials for the `migrate-runner` service this morning. The old key stops working Friday. The expand-contract migrations in flight are unaffected; the runner picked up the new credential automatically. If you run migrations manually from the release host, update your config with the key below.

— Priya (invented)

gateway credential: kto23_LX9A4ys6i4nzHtpOLNLodKK

## Log Sampling — Chirret Service

Chirret emits roughly two thousand log lines per second under normal load, so plugin authors must respect the sampling contract. Set LOG_SAMPLE_RATE between 0.01 and 0.1 in your plugin's env file; anything higher will be throttled by the collector. Debug-level output is sampled separately via LOG_DEBUG_SAMPLE and should stay at 0.01 unless you are reproducing an incident. Sampled logs are shipped to the Farrowline aggregator, which authenticates each plugin with a per-tenant key set on the following line.

vault entry, yahaf-tagug: LEDGER_TOKEN20=884d77d1a8b98aa4edfb